Their entire world was shut down and is now in the process of reformatting and rebooting .

Most of the security leaders I am talking with are struggling with how to reopen safely , attract visitors , and stay open indefinitely .

One thing I know for sure : there will be no going back to the old screening procedures .

Why ? Because three waves of change are combining to crest and crash down on the thresholds of their venues at the same time .

The future of people screening will be quite different indeed , but it will be much , much better — at least for those who learn to adapt .

So , what are these three waves of change ?

They are the Normalization of Pandemics , Armed Anxiety , and the Digital Transformation of Physical Security .

Let ’ s look at each in detail .

Wave 1 : Normalization of Pandemics

Pandemic viruses turn unwitting visitors into weapons .

COVID-19 has weaponized people in a way never seen before .

Everyone now knows that packed crowds and human contact multiply the danger .
